Polycystic Ovary Syndrome (PCOS) is a complex endocrine disorder affecting numerous women worldwide. Characterized by hormonal imbalances, metabolic issues, and reproductive challenges, PCOS is a leading cause of infertility. Understanding the intricate relationship between PCOS and infertility is crucial for effective management and improving reproductive outcomes.
One of the hallmark features of PCOS is anovulation, or the absence of ovulation. This condition leads to irregular menstrual cycles, making it challenging for women to predict fertile windows. Without regular ovulation, the release of eggs necessary for fertilization is inconsistent, significantly reducing the chances of conception. According to Dr. Rachel Corradetti-Sargeant, ND, 80% of ovulatory infertility cases are attributed to PCOS. This statistic underscores the profound impact that irregular ovulation has on fertility among women with this condition.
Insulin Resistance and Its Effect on Reproductive Hormones
Insulin resistance is a common metabolic disturbance in women with PCOS. In this condition, the body’s cells become less responsive to insulin, leading to elevated blood glucose levels. To compensate, the pancreas produces more insulin, resulting in hyperinsulinemia. This excess insulin can disrupt the delicate balance of reproductive hormones by increasing androgen production from the ovaries. Elevated androgen levels can inhibit normal follicular development, leading to anovulation and contributing to infertility. Addressing insulin resistance through lifestyle modifications and, when necessary, medical interventions is vital for restoring ovulatory function and enhancing fertility.
The Role of Androgens in PCOS-Related Infertility
Androgens, often referred to as male hormones, are present in both men and women but are typically found in lower levels in females. Women with PCOS often exhibit elevated androgen levels, a condition known as hyperandrogenism. This hormonal imbalance can manifest in clinical symptoms such as hirsutism (excessive hair growth), acne, and male-pattern hair loss. Beyond these physical manifestations, high androgen levels can interfere with the normal maturation of ovarian follicles, preventing ovulation and thereby contributing to infertility. Managing androgen levels through targeted therapies and lifestyle changes is essential for improving reproductive outcomes in women with PCOS.
Diet and Lifestyle Strategies to Improve Fertility in PCOS
Implementing specific diet and lifestyle modifications can significantly enhance fertility outcomes for women with PCOS.
-
Dietary Adjustments:
- Increase Fibre Intake: Consuming a diet rich in fiber aids in improving insulin sensitivity and promoting hormonal balance. High-fiber foods help regulate blood sugar levels, which is crucial for managing PCOS symptoms.
- Prioritize Protein: Incorporating adequate protein into meals supports satiety and assists in blood sugar regulation, contributing to overall metabolic health.
-
Physical Activity:
Regular exercise plays a pivotal role in managing PCOS by improving insulin sensitivity, aiding in weight management, and promoting regular ovulation. Engaging in both aerobic and resistance training exercises can be particularly beneficial.
-
Stress Management and Sleep:
Chronic stress and inadequate sleep can exacerbate insulin resistance and hormonal imbalances. Incorporating stress-reducing techniques such as mindfulness, meditation, and ensuring sufficient sleep are critical components of a comprehensive PCOS management plan.
-
Supplementation:
Certain supplements have shown promise in managing PCOS symptoms and improving fertility:
- Myo-Inositol: Supports insulin sensitivity and ovarian function.
- Berberine: May improve metabolic parameters and reduce androgen levels.
- N-Acetylcysteine (NAC): Known for its antioxidant properties, it may enhance ovulation rates.
- White Peony and Licorice Root: Herbal remedies that may help balance hormones.
- Spearmint: May reduce hirsutism by lowering androgen levels.

Stress and Its Influence on Hormonal Balance in PCOS
Stress is a significant factor that can negatively impact hormonal balance in women with PCOS. Elevated stress levels can lead to increased production of cortisol, a hormone that can interfere with insulin function and exacerbate insulin resistance. Moreover, stress can disrupt the hypothalamic-pituitary-ovarian axis, further impairing ovulation and contributing to infertility. Implementing effective stress management techniques, such as yoga, meditation, and counseling, can help mitigate these effects and support overall hormonal health.
